What is Natural Coconut Sugar?
Natural coconut sugar is made from the sap of the coconut palm tree’s flower buds. Farmers tap the flowers to collect sap, which is then gently heated until the water evaporates, leaving golden-brown crystals. Unlike refined sugar, it undergoes minimal processing and retains small amounts of vitamins, minerals, and plant compounds.
Coconut sugar’s main components are:
- Sucrose (70–80%)
- Glucose and fructose (the remainder)
- Trace minerals: iron, zinc, calcium, potassium
- Inulin – a type of dietary fiber with prebiotic properties
The Role of the Gut Microbiome

The gut is home to trillions of microorganisms, collectively called the gut microbiome, which play a critical role in digestion, nutrient absorption, immune function, and even mood regulation. A healthy microbiome typically has a balance of beneficial bacteria that thrive on dietary fiber and plant-based compounds.
Prebiotics—compounds that feed beneficial gut bacteria—are an important part of maintaining gut health. One of the interesting aspects of coconut sugar is that it contains inulin, a natural prebiotic fiber.
Inulin in Coconut Sugar
Inulin is a type of soluble fiber found in various plants, including chicory root, garlic, and onions. It is non-digestible by humans, meaning it passes through the upper digestive tract intact until it reaches the colon, where beneficial bacteria ferment it.
The fermentation process produces short-chain fatty acids (SCFAs) like butyrate, propionate, and acetate, which:
- Support colon health
- Reduce inflammation
- Improve gut barrier function
- Potentially regulate blood sugar
While coconut sugar is not a high-fiber food, the presence of small amounts of inulin could offer a modest benefit for the microbiome.

Limitations and Considerations
While coconut sugar contains beneficial compounds, it is still sugar and should be consumed in moderation. Overconsumption of any sugar—natural or refined—can disrupt the microbiome by promoting the growth of less favorable bacteria and yeast.
Limitations include:
- Low fiber content compared to dedicated prebiotic foods (like onions, garlic, or asparagus)
- Caloric density similar to table sugar (about 15–16 calories per teaspoon)
- Limited scientific studies specifically linking coconut sugar to gut health

The Science Gap
Research on coconut sugar’s direct effect on gut health is still emerging. While studies on inulin and prebiotics are well-established, there is little clinical evidence specifically studying coconut sugar’s microbiome benefits. Most of the proposed gut-friendly effects are inferred from its inulin content and low glycemic index.
Future studies could focus on:
- Comparing gut bacterial diversity in coconut sugar vs. refined sugar consumers
- Measuring SCFA production after coconut sugar intake
- Long-term impacts on digestion and immune function
